SOLUTION:

Case: Area of rectangles

Method:

Let the width be 'w'

The length, 'l' is 5 yards less than three times the width.

Hence,

l = 3w - 5

Since the Area, A = 28 sq yards

[tex]\begin{gathered} A=l\times w \\ 28=(3w-5)w \\ 28=3w^2-5w \\ 3w^2-5w-28=0 \\ 3w^2-12w+7w-28=0 \\ 3w(w-4)+7(w-4)=0 \\ (3w+7)(w-4)=0 \\ 3w+7=0 \\ 3w=-7 \\ w=\frac{-7}{3}(invalid) \\ OR \\ w-4=0 \\ w=4 \end{gathered}[/tex]

If the width w= 4 yards

Hence,

l = 3w - 5

l = 3(4) -5

l = 12 - 5

l = 7 yards

Final answer:

Length : 7 yd

Width : 4 yd
